Damaged roof replacement services involve removing existing roofing materials that have sustained significant damage and installing new roofing systems to restore the property's protection.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of for issues such as leaks, missing shingles, or structural deterioration, followed by the careful removal of compromised materials. Once the damaged sections are cleared, experienced contractors install new roofing components, ensuring the structure is secure and weather-resistant. The goal is to provide a durable, long-lasting roof that can withstand future weather conditions and prevent further damage.

This service addresses a variety of problems caused by roof damage, including leaks, water intrusion, and structural instability. Persistent leaks can lead to interior water damage, mold growth, and compromised insulation, which can affect the property's safety and energy efficiency. Additionally, extensive damage from storms, hail, fallen branches, or aging materials may weaken the roof’s integrity, increasing the risk of collapse or further deterioration. Replacing a damaged roof helps eliminate these issues, safeguarding the property and its occupants from potential hazards and cost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newark,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Damaged roof replacement services typically range from $5,000 to $15,000 depending on the size and material. For example, replacing a standard asphalt shingle roof in Newark, OH might cost around $8,000. Costs vary based on the extent of damage and roof complexity.

Material Expenses - The choice of roofing material influences overall expenses, with asphalt shingles costing approximately $100 to $200 per square. Metal roofing might range from $150 to $350 per square, affecting total replacement costs accordingly.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material selections.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for damaged roof replacement gener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project cost. In Newark, OH, labor charges could be around $2,500 to $7,000 for a typical residential roof. These fees depend on the roof’s size and accessibility.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include tear-off of old roofing, disposal fees, and structural repairs, which can add $1,000 to $3,000. Variations depend on the extent of damage and required repairs, with local service providers offering detailed est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of roof damage that require replacement? Signs include missing or broken shingles, extensive water stains on ceilings, visible sagging, and persistent leaks during rain.

How long does a damaged ro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age, but generally, replacement can take from a few days to a week.

Will insurance cover roof replacement due to damage? Coverage depends on the policy and cause of damage; contacting a local contractor can help assess if the damage is eligible for insurance claims.

What factors influence the cost of damaged roof replacement? Costs are influenced by roof size, materials used, extent of damage, and accessibility of the property.
